


Discover the flavors and fermentation traditions of the Chita Peninsula on this private culinary experience from Nagoya.
Begin at Sawada Sake Brewery, a historic brewery founded in 1848, where generations of craftsmanship have shaped one of Chita’s enduring sake traditions. Guided by the brewery owner, step inside the brewery and discover how the region’s climate, local ingredients, and traditional techniques influence its sake. Along the way, gain a deeper appreciation for the fermentation culture that has long been part of life on the Chita Peninsula.
While alcoholic tastings are not included during the brewery visit, you will receive a selection of gifts from Sawada Sake Brewery, including a 300 ml bottle of “Hakuro,” to enjoy at home.
The experience continues at Le Coeuryuzu, an acclaimed restaurant featured in a leading Japanese gourmet guide. Award-winning Chef Watanabe creates a special course centered on carefully selected seasonal ingredients from Chita and the surrounding region, bringing out the distinctive character of each ingredient. The meal is accompanied by a curated beverage pairing featuring sake from Sawada Sake Brewery, connecting what you discovered at the brewery with the flavors on your plate.
Together, the brewery visit and pairing lunch offer an intimate taste of Chita’s culinary identity, where sake, seasonal ingredients, and generations of craftsmanship come together.
